A RESOLUTION OF THE LODI CITY COUNCIL
DEFERRING THE STATUS OF THE CITY OF LODI AS A METROPOLITAN CITY
UNDER THE CO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T BLOCK GRANT PROGRAM
WHEREAS, the Housing and Community Development Act of 1974 as
amended provides that the City of Lodi may elect to have its population
included in a qualifying "urban county" for the purposes of entitlement
funding; and
WHEREAS, such election requires that the City of Lodi defer its
classification as a "metropolitan city", and as such its standing as an
independently entitled community, under the Community Development Block
Grant Program; and
WHEREAS, it is agreed that the City of Lodi shall defer its
classification as a "metropolitan city" prior to the formal allocation
of fiscal year 1991 CDBG funds; and
WHEREAS, by having its population included in an "urban county",
the City of Lodi will receive entitlement funding jointly with the
County of San Joaquin and other included cities;
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Lodi City Council as
follows:
1. The City of Lodi hereby defers its classification as a
"metropolitan city" under Title I of the Housing and Community
Development Act of 1974 as amended.
2. Such deferment is subject to the qualification of an "urban
county" to be evidenced by the execution of cooperation
agreements between the County of San Joaquin and its
participating cities, which contain the requisite population, and
the acceptance of those agreements by the Department of Housing
and Urban Development.
3. Such deferment is coterminous with the qualification period
of the cooperation agreement between the City of Lodi and the
County of San Joaquin, that is, Federal fiscal years 1991, 1992,
and 1993.
4. The City Manager is authorized and directed to submit this
resolution as written notification to the Secretary of Housing
and Urban Development of the deferment of "metropolitan city"
status by the City of Lodi.
PASSED AND ADOPTED the 1st day of August 1990 by the following vote:
